In no event will the authors be held liable for any damages @@ -935,6 +935,19 @@ static const GuessTest guess_tests[] = } }; +/* The Linux kernel provides capability info in EVIOCGBIT and in /sys + * as an array of unsigned long in native byte order, rather than an array + * of bytes, an array of native-endian 32-bit words or an array of + * native-endian 64-bit words like you might have reasonably expected. + * The order of words in the array is always lowest-valued first: for + * instance, the first unsigned long in abs[] contains the bit representing + * absolute axis 0 (ABS_X). + * + * The constant arrays above provide test data in little-endian, because + * that's the easiest representation for hard-coding into a test like this. + * On a big-endian platform we need to byteswap it, one unsigned long at a + * time, to match what the kernel would produce. This requires us to choose + * an appropriate byteswapping function for the architecture's word size. */ SDL_COMPILE_TIME_ASSERT(sizeof_long, sizeof(unsigned long) == 4 || sizeof(unsigned long) == 8); #define SwapLongLE(X) \ ((sizeof(unsigned long) == 4) ?
